Korg has posted Building Stadium Sounds Part 1 – Program Mode, the first video of a new tutorial series with Jon Shone, the Musical Director for One Direction. They say that these videos are all about giving you some ideas on what could help your sound stand out in busy mixes and/or large venues.

A spokesperson told us, "As the Musical Director for One Direction, Jon Shone has toured the world playing some of the world's biggest gigs. In this video series, he gives an insight to how he uses the KORG KRONOS on the One Direction tours and a beginner's guide to editing and creating sounds fit for a stadium tour. Maybe most of us will never get to play a stadium gig, but we can but dream."
